The Committee Against Sexual Harassment (CASH), Government Degree College for Women, Anantnag, organized an extension lecture and theatrical programme on 15 April 2026 at 11:30 AM in the college auditorium. The programme commenced with a welcome address by the Convener, Dr Gousia Khan, highlighting the relevance of awareness, rights, and institutional responsibility in addressing issues of gender and safety. This was followed by a theatrical play titled “Safe Spaces, Strong Voices: Addressing Sexual Harassment in Contemporary Society,” enacted by students of 2nd and 6th Semester. The play depicted situations of harassment and responses within institutional spaces. It emphasized the need for awareness, reporting mechanisms, and collective responsibility. An extension lecture on “Respect, Rights and Responsibility – A Conversation on Gender” was delivered by the resource person, Syed Urfa Ajaz, Prosecuting Officer (G). The lecture outlined key legal provisions and rights related to gender issues. It also addressed the role of individuals and institutions in ensuring accountability and safe environments.
